Lines Matching refs:argc

3149 	unsigned int argc;
3159 if (!as->argc)
3162 r = dm_read_arg_group(_args, as, &argc, &ti->error);
3166 while (argc && !r) {
3168 argc--;
3287 static int pool_ctr(struct dm_target *ti, unsigned int argc, char **argv)
3305 if (argc < 4) {
3311 as.argc = argc;
3682 static int check_arg_count(unsigned int argc, unsigned int args_required)
3684 if (argc != args_required) {
3686 argc, args_required);
3705 static int process_create_thin_mesg(unsigned int argc, char **argv, struct pool *pool)
3710 r = check_arg_count(argc, 2);
3728 static int process_create_snap_mesg(unsigned int argc, char **argv, struct pool *pool)
3734 r = check_arg_count(argc, 3);
3756 static int process_delete_mesg(unsigned int argc, char **argv, struct pool *pool)
3761 r = check_arg_count(argc, 2);
3776 static int process_set_transaction_id_mesg(unsigned int argc, char **argv, struct pool *pool)
3781 r = check_arg_count(argc, 3);
3805 static int process_reserve_metadata_snap_mesg(unsigned int argc, char **argv, struct pool *pool)
3809 r = check_arg_count(argc, 1);
3822 static int process_release_metadata_snap_mesg(unsigned int argc, char **argv, struct pool *pool)
3826 r = check_arg_count(argc, 1);
3846 static int pool_message(struct dm_target *ti, unsigned int argc, char **argv,
3860 r = process_create_thin_mesg(argc, argv, pool);
3863 r = process_create_snap_mesg(argc, argv, pool);
3866 r = process_delete_mesg(argc, argv, pool);
3869 r = process_set_transaction_id_mesg(argc, argv, pool);
3872 r = process_reserve_metadata_snap_mesg(argc, argv, pool);
3875 r = process_release_metadata_snap_mesg(argc, argv, pool);
4185 static int thin_ctr(struct dm_target *ti, unsigned int argc, char **argv)
4194 if (argc != 2 && argc != 3) {
4213 if (argc == 3) {